The Man Behind the Headline: Who is Richard Lavender?

Richard Lavender is a prominent businessman, horse breeder, and equestrian who has spent decades cultivating a reputation within Australia’s prestigious equestrian circles. Now in his mid-60s, Richard is known for his deep affinity for land, livestock, and country living. Far removed from the metropolitan social scenes of Sydney and Melbourne, Richard has long called the picturesque Southern Highlands of New South Wales home. His sprawling historic property, located near the quiet township of Berrima, serves as the hub of his equestrian endeavors and personal sanctuary.

While Richard is not a media personality, he is highly respected in his field. Over the years, he has built a successful career centered around horse training, breeding, and agricultural investments. Those who know him describe him as a humble, softly-spoken gentleman with a dry sense of humor and an unwavering love for the outdoors. His grounded nature provided a perfect counterweight to the intense, often chaotic lifestyle that Sam experienced during her eight-year tenure on the Sunrise couch.

Prior to his relationship with Sam, Richard was married once before and is the proud father of two adult daughters, Sasha and Grace. His daughters share his passion for the countryside and horses, and they have reportedly welcomed Sam into their close-knit family with open arms. Richard’s established family life and deep roots in the Southern Highlands provided a sense of stability that immediately attracted Sam when their paths first crossed.

How Sam Armytage and Richard Lavender Met

The love story of Sam Armytage and her husband began in the Easter of 2019. Despite moving in entirely different social circles, the pair was introduced by a mutual friend who recognized that they shared a deep love for rural Australia, dogs, and the quiet life. The introduction took place in the Southern Highlands, where Sam owned a luxury weekend retreat in Bowral. The attraction was immediate, anchored by their shared values and appreciation for life outside the media bubble.

During the early stages of their courtship, the couple kept their relationship strictly under wraps. For Sam, who had spent years seeing her personal life scrutinized by paparazzi, the privacy of the Southern Highlands provided a safe haven. The couple spent their weekends horse riding, walking their dogs, and enjoying quiet dinners away from the public eye. This period of quiet bonding allowed their relationship to develop a solid foundation built on genuine companionship rather than public perception.

By mid-2020, the relationship had progressed to a point where they were ready to take the next step. In June of that year, Richard proposed to Sam on his Berrima property. The proposal was classically understated, reflecting Richard’s personality. He asked Sam to marry him during a casual stroll trace across his paddocks, presenting her with a stunning solitaire diamond ring. Sam shared the news with her followers on social media with a simple picture of the couple, captioned with a joyful announcement that quickly captured the hearts of her Australian fan base.

The Intimate New Year’s Eve Wedding

Sam Armytage and Richard Lavender officially tied the knot on December 31, 2020. Amidst the challenges and travel restrictions of the COVID-19 pandemic, the couple opted for a highly intimate, registry-style wedding rather than a lavish celebrity affair. The ceremony was held at Richard’s stunning private property in Berrima, surrounded by a very select group of immediate family members, including Sam’s father, Mac, and her sister, Georgie.

The wedding aesthetic was a beautiful reflection of country elegance. Sam wore a chic, knee-length white dress by high-end designer Carla Zampatti, paired with a delicate matching headpiece, while Richard looked dapper in a classic tweed jacket, waistcoat, and moleskin trousers. The ceremony was simple, raw, and focused entirely on the love between the couple and the blending of their families.

Following the exchange of vows, the small wedding party celebrated with an intimate luncheon on the estate. The private nature of the event allowed the newlyweds to celebrate without the intrusion of external media, setting a clear precedent for how they intended to conduct their married life moving forward. It was a day marked by rustic simplicity, family warmth, and a shared excitement for the future.

The Transition to Country Living: Pros and Cons of Their New Life

Shortly after her marriage to Richard, Sam made the monumental decision to step down from her role on Sunrise in March 2021. This decision was heavily influenced by her desire to prioritize her marriage and mental well-being over the relentless demands of daily television. Living permanently in the Southern Highlands with Richard has brought about significant lifestyle shifts.



The Benefits of Their Rural Partnership



  • Peace and Privacy: Leaving metropolitan Sydney allowed Sam to escape the constant pursuit of the paparazzi and the high-stress environment of live television.
  • Shared Passions: Both Sam and Richard are avid horse riders. Living on a fully functional horse property allows them to indulge in their favorite hobby together daily.
  • Grounded Family Focus: The lifestyle change has given Sam the time to focus on being a stepmother to Richard’s daughters and a supportive partner in his local business ventures.
  • Creative Rejuvenation: Free from the daily grind, Sam has been able to pursue selective media projects, including hosting her podcast Something to Talk About and appearing on Seven's Farmer Wants a Wife, both of which align better with her country lifestyle.


The Challenges of Transitioning from Metro to Rural



  • Professional Adjustments: Stepping away from a prime-time television hosting gig means adjusting to a slower professional pace and fewer high-profile media opportunities.
  • Isolation from City Networks: Moving permanently to the Southern Highlands distances Sam from her long-term professional networks based in Sydney and Melbourne.
  • The Demands of Farm Life: Maintaining a large country estate and managing horses requires significant physical labor and constant attention, quite different from city apartment living.
